Most passenger cars require about 1 to 2 hours of labor to replace an alternator, though the time can range from around 0.5 hours to 4 hours depending on the vehicle.
In practice, the exact labor depends on the vehicle design, engine layout, and whether other components must be moved or removed to access the alternator. This article breaks down the typical time ranges and the factors that influence them.
What affects the labor time
Several factors determine how long it takes to replace an alternator. The following list highlights the most impactful elements that professionals weigh when quoting hours.
- Vehicle design and engine layout: how the alternator is mounted and routed within the engine bay
- Accessibility: whether the belt and mounting bolts are easy to reach
- Serpentine belt routing and tensioner access: whether the belt can be removed quickly or requires special tools
- Disassembly requirements: if other components (AC compressor, power steering pump, exhaust, or intake components) must be moved or removed
- Electrical connections: the number and complexity of plugs and wiring harnesses
- Replacement scope: whether the job includes replacing the belt, tensioner, or pulley as preventive maintenance
- Vehicle type and model year: some recent designs place the alternator in a cramped space or behind other parts
- Shop resources: whether the technician needs to consult service manuals or special tools
In sum, accessibility and the need to remove other parts largely drive the time, with simpler, well-exposed installations taking less time and complex layouts taking longer.
Typical labor hours by accessibility
Repair manuals and shop estimates commonly categorize labor by how accessible the alternator is. Here are rough ranges many shops use as a starting point.
- Easy-access installations: about 0.5 to 1.5 hours
- Average accessibility: about 1 to 2 hours
- Difficult access: about 2 to 4 hours
- Very difficult or specialized setups (some trucks, hybrids, or engines with tight interiors): about 3 to 6 hours
These figures are general guidelines. The actual quote from a repair shop will reflect your specific vehicle, the local labor rate, and any additional work the technician recommends.
Replacement process — step-by-step overview
The following outline reflects a typical sequence used by shops when replacing an alternator on a standard four- or six-cylinder engine. Some models may differ.
Step-by-step outline
- Disconnect the negative battery cable and, if applicable, disconnect the positive terminal to prevent arcing.
- Relieve residual electrical pressure and drain any necessary fluids if the vehicle’s service manual requires it.
- Release tension on the serpentine belt and remove it from the alternator pulley.
- Disconnect electrical connectors and remove mounting bolts holding the alternator in place.
- Remove the old alternator and compare with the replacement to ensure correct fitment.
- Install the new alternator, torque mounting bolts to specification, and reconnect electrical connections.
- Reinstall the belt, check belt routing, and restore serpentine belt tension or ensure the belt tensioner is functioning properly.
- Reconnect the battery and start the engine; monitor charging system voltage and check for warning lights.
Note: Some vehicles require extra steps or the removal of other components for access. If you are not experienced with car electrical systems, professional installation is recommended to avoid battery or alternator damage.
